Output 63fb8df88f566dd6c63e51355790790e9cbf718bea5e54f3cfd6627e1464c8d5:0

value
4575973
script pubkey
OP_0 OP_PUSHBYTES_20 03592e034e69db88f24bffa4d39f3e8aab1d76ea
address
ltc1qqdvjuq6wd8dc3ujtl7jd88e732436ah2c9qg7e
transaction
63fb8df88f566dd6c63e51355790790e9cbf718bea5e54f3cfd6627e1464c8d5
spent
true